Three parts treatment, seven parts maintenance

Mainly dietary therapy

1. Low-fiber, low-fat foods can promote intestinal motility and stimulate the intestinal wall, but they are difficult to digest and are not good for the intestines, so they should be limited.

2. Pay attention to supplementing protein and vitamins.

3. If chronic enteritis causes dehydration and low sodium, you should replenish your body with light salt water and drink vegetable leaf soup to replenish the loss of water, salt and vitamins.

4. When flatulence and diarrhea are too severe, you should eat less sugar and easily fermented foods, such as potatoes, beans, milk, etc.

5. Persimmons, pomegranates, and apples all contain tannic acid and pectin, which have astringent and antidiarrheal effects. They can be eaten in moderation by people with chronic colitis.
